## Major Infrastructure and Regional Projects: Progress and Promises
El Paso’s revitalization agenda is gaining momentum with several high-profile projects designed to enhance regional connectivity, cultural identity, and economic competitiveness:
- **Bridge of the Americas Modernization**: The U.S. General Services Administration (GSA) reaffirmed an **updated timeline** for this crucial border infrastructure upgrade. The enhancements are focused on **improving safety, capacity, and operational efficiency**, which are vital for facilitating **smoother cross-border trade** and **border security**. Although specific completion dates are pending, officials emphasize that these improvements are essential to maintaining El Paso’s status as one of the busiest border crossings in North America.
- **Cross-Border Tram Connecting El Paso and Juárez Airports**: Progress on this binational transit project has accelerated, with city officials actively seeking funding. The proposed tram aims to **connect El Paso with Juárez’s airports**, **ease congestion**, and **strengthen economic and social ties** between the two cities. This project exemplifies El Paso’s commitment to becoming a **regional transportation hub** and fostering deeper cross-border cooperation.
- **I-10 Art Corridor**: This innovative initiative seeks to **transform transit routes into vibrant cultural spaces**. By integrating visual art installations along the highway, the city aims to **beautify daily commutes**, **attract tourists**, and **celebrate El Paso’s unique cultural identity**. The corridor aspires to **boost local pride** and **drive tourism-related economic activity**.
- **$10 Million Downtown Deck Plaza**: As part of broader urban renewal, this expansive public space is designed to **stimulate downtown businesses**, **host cultural and community events**, and **catalyze further development** in the city’s core. Civic leaders view it as a **key element in revitalizing downtown El Paso**, fostering **civic engagement** and **economic vibrancy**.
### New Developments in Economic Diversification
El Paso is actively positioning itself as a hub for **technology and advanced manufacturing**:
- The city is hosting **forums focused on establishing large-scale data centers**, recognizing their potential to generate **high-paying, knowledge-based jobs** and **elevate regional prominence**.
- Efforts to **attract advanced manufacturing and industrial facilities** are underway through targeted policies, aiming to **enhance competitiveness** and **create sustainable employment opportunities**.
- In workforce development, initiatives like **wastewater operator training in the Rio Grande Valley** are addressing labor shortages while preparing residents for emerging technical careers.
- The **El Paso Community Foundation** continues to support community development, offering over **$6.7 million annually in grants** to bolster local organizations and projects, fostering an environment of **inclusive growth**.

## Law Enforcement Integrity and Regional Implications
Adding a significant layer to oversight concerns, a recent high-profile case involves the **sentencing of a former El Paso Border Officer for corruption**. The officer was convicted of accepting bribes and engaging in misconduct, which **undermines public trust** in border security agencies and highlights the ongoing need for **rigorous oversight and accountability**.
This case underscores the importance of **transparency in border enforcement** and calls for reforms to **prevent corruption** within law enforcement ranks, especially given El Paso’s strategic position at the U.S.-Mexico border.

### Recent Developments: Federal and Regional Oversight
A notable recent development involves the **sentencing of a former El Paso Border Officer for corruption**, which sends a strong message about **law enforcement accountability**. The officer received a **10-year federal prison sentence** after admitting to accepting Rolex watches, cash bribes, and engaging in misconduct. This case highlights the ongoing efforts to **root out corruption** and **restore public trust** in border security agencies.
